Best places to live in Colorado
CityLedger tracks 7 Colorado metros, led by Denver. Cost of living runs from about 92 to 106 against a U.S. average of 100. Every figure below is computed from public U.S. government data and links to a full profile.
| Metro | Livability | Cost of living | Median income | Median rent |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Denver, CO | 83 | 106 | $108,046 | $1,943/mo |
| Boulder, CO | 83 | 105 | $102,697 | $1,966/mo |
| Fort Collins, CO | 75 | 101 | $93,276 | $1,751/mo |
| Greeley, CO | 70 | 100 | $101,563 | $1,579/mo |
| Colorado Springs, CO | 63 | 101 | $90,760 | $1,761/mo |
| Grand Junction, CO | 50 | 95 | $75,231 | $1,259/mo |
| Pueblo, CO | 37 | 92 | $62,128 | $1,128/mo |
